encantos
"Encantos" means "charms" or "delights."
In this sentence, 'encantos' refers to the appealing and attractive features or characteristics of a place.
Os encantos da cidade antiga são indescritíveis.
The charms of the old city are indescribable.
Here, 'encantos' refers to the personal qualities or attributes that make someone appealing or attractive.
Ela conquistou a todos com seus encantos.
She won everyone over with her charms.
